Description:

Pre-Columbian, North Coast Peru, Chancay culture, ca. 1000 to 1470 CE. This earthen-toned textile panel is comprised of semi-tightly woven fibers in shades of brown, gold, black, cream, and red. The composition of the bottom half is comprised of alternating rows of gold, red, and cream hexagonal shapes, and the top half of sharply-angled gold and cream lines which create vertical columns of thick-walled pyramids. Mounted on a fabric-lined cardboard backing. Size: 9.5" L x 4.75" W (24.1 cm x 12.1 cm).

Provenance: private Slavin collection, acquired in Peru and Bolivia between 1971 and 1972
